The exchange of driving licenses issued by foreign countries not acceding to the International Convention on Road Traffic depends on taking and passing the practical test driving test, for each category of the driver holds. Yet the inscription in driving school does not is required, so that the driver can autopropor examination Licences issued by EU and EEA countries are valid in Portugal, and need not be exchanged while they remain valid. EU licences that do not already state an expiry date, or if the date does not coincide with a date imposed by national driving regulations, must be exchanged within two years of the holder taking up residence in Portugal.
Licences issued in some countries are not valid in Portugal beyond a fixed period. A licence which is valid for a fixed period may be exchanged for a Portuguese one, or may not be exchanged at all, depending on the country of issue. If a licence cannot not be exchanged the licence holder must take a full driving test (theory and practical) in order to get a Portuguese driving licence.
Drivers who hold a licence issued by another EU or EEA country and who are resident in Portugal are obliged to register with their regional or district Department of Motor Vehicles (IMTT) office within 60 days of establishing residency
The movement in the country is not allowed to drivers with securities issued by non-member countries to these international conventions.
